✅ What role did I play on my team?
In my final year project "Smart Lab Networking with Azure and Dedicated Server", I independently took charge of the complete planning, setup, and deployment process. From designing the network architecture to physically connecting switches and configuring servers, every major component of the project was handled by me. I installed and configured Windows Server 2022, set up DHCP, DNS, and Active Directory, and ensured all clients received proper IP addressing and access control.
Although this was a team project, I worked mostly independently and took full ownership of the core technical tasks. I coordinated with my faculty advisor only for approval and updates. From resolving configuration issues to setting up the cloud integration via Azure Arc, I managed everything by researching, testing, and implementing solutions on my own — including using Microsoft documentation, community forums, and hands-on troubleshooting.
The result was a fully functional, secure, and smart lab network. The server was connected with Azure, enabling remote monitoring, automatic backup, and performance analytics. I resolved DHCP conflicts, fixed DNS resolution errors, configured firewall and agent settings, and successfully deployed a hybrid infrastructure. The project not only fulfilled all academic requirements but also stood out for its real-world applicability — all of which I achieved through my own dedication, learning, and hands-on practice.
